As a creative professional, you may be more focused on capturing beautiful moments or creating captivating videos than balancing your books. However, neglecting the financial aspect of your business can have serious consequences. Bookkeeping plays a vital role in managing your finances, tracking your income and expenses, and ensuring compliance with tax regulations. It provides you with valuable insights into the financial health of your business and helps you make informed decisions to drive growth.
In the world of photography and videography, where projects and clients come and go, bookkeeping enables you to keep tabs on your cash flow. It helps you accurately record payments received and monitor outstanding invoices. By maintaining a clear picture of your finances, you can proactively pursue unpaid invoices and ensure the sustainability of your business.
Furthermore, bookkeeping allows you to have a better understanding of your revenue streams. By categorizing your income based on different projects or clients, you can identify which areas of your business are the most profitable. This information can guide your marketing efforts and help you attract more clients in those lucrative areas.
Additionally, bookkeeping enables you to analyze your expenses and identify areas where you can cut costs. Understanding your spending patterns is crucial for budgeting and financial planning, enabling you to allocate resources more efficiently and maximize profitability. For example, by tracking your equipment expenses, you can determine if it's more cost-effective to rent or purchase certain items.
Accurate bookkeeping is not just a requirement for tax purposes; it's an essential tool for business growth. When your books are in order, you can generate accurate financial reports that provide valuable insights into your business performance. These reports allow you to assess profitability, track trends, and identify opportunities for improvement.
Moreover, accurate bookkeeping ensures compliance with tax regulations, minimizing the risk of penalties and legal issues that can damage your business reputation. It also simplifies the process of filing tax returns, saving you time and reducing stress during tax season.
Furthermore, accurate bookkeeping can help you with long-term financial planning. By analyzing your financial records, you can identify patterns and trends that can inform your business decisions. For instance, if you notice that certain months are consistently slower in terms of revenue, you can plan ahead and allocate resources accordingly to mitigate any potential financial strain.

Financial Reporting and Analysis
Keeping track of your financial performance is crucial for making informed business decisions. A skilled bookkeeping service can generate detailed financial reports, such as profit and loss statements, balance sheets, and cash flow statements. These reports provide a comprehensive overview of your business's financial health, allowing you to identify trends, track expenses, and evaluate your profitability.
By analyzing these reports, you can gain valuable insights into your revenue streams, cost structures, and areas where you can optimize your finances. This knowledge empowers you to make strategic decisions that improve your bottom line.
Tax Preparation and Planning
Taxes can be a daunting aspect of running a photography or videography business. Navigating complex tax regulations and ensuring compliance can be time-consuming and stressful. However, a bookkeeping service can alleviate this burden by handling your tax preparation and planning.
Experienced bookkeepers can help identify tax deductions and credits that you may have overlooked, minimizing your tax liability. They also ensure that all your financial documents are organized and readily available during tax season, making the filing process smoother and more efficient.
Payroll Management
If you have employees or hire freelancers, managing payroll can be a tedious task. Bookkeeping services can take care of this for you, ensuring accurate and timely payment processing, calculating employee benefits, and handling payroll tax compliance.
By outsourcing your payroll management, you can save time, reduce errors, and ensure that your employees are paid correctly and on time. This allows you to focus on growing your business and nurturing your creative talents.
Expense Tracking and Budgeting
As a photographer or videographer, it's important to keep a close eye on your expenses and maintain a well-planned budget. A bookkeeping service can help you track your expenses and create a budget that aligns with your business goals.
By categorizing your expenses and monitoring your spending patterns, bookkeepers can provide valuable insights into areas where you can cut costs or reallocate resources. This helps you optimize your financial resources and ensure that you are making the most out of your investments.
Client Invoicing and Accounts Receivable
Managing client invoices and accounts receivable can be time-consuming, especially when you have multiple projects and clients to juggle. A bookkeeping service can handle this process for you, ensuring that your invoices are sent out promptly and that you receive timely payments.
By streamlining your invoicing and accounts receivable processes, you can improve your cash flow and reduce the risk of late or missed payments. This allows you to focus on providing exceptional services to your clients without worrying about the administrative tasks associated with billing and collections.

Outsourcing your bookkeeping services can provide numerous benefits for your photography or videography business. By entrusting your financial management to professionals, you can free up valuable time and resources to focus on your core business activities.
One of the key advantages of outsourcing bookkeeping is the access to specialized expertise. Professional bookkeepers who specialize in working with creative professionals understand the intricacies of the industry and can provide valuable insights and guidance. They can help you navigate tax regulations, optimize cash flow, and make informed financial decisions.
Additionally, outsourcing bookkeeping can lead to increased accuracy and efficiency. Professional bookkeepers have the necessary skills and experience to handle complex financial transactions and ensure that your records are accurate and up to date. This can help you avoid costly errors and penalties.
Another benefit of outsourcing is the utilization of advanced technology. Many bookkeeping service providers use cutting-edge accounting software and tools to streamline processes and provide real-time financial data. This allows you to have a clear and comprehensive view of your business's financial health, enabling you to make informed decisions and plan for the future.
Lastly, outsourcing bookkeeping can provide cost savings. Instead of hiring an in-house bookkeeper, which can be expensive and require additional resources, outsourcing allows you to pay for the services you need on a flexible basis. This can help you manage your budget effectively and allocate resources where they are needed most.
